Youth Advisory Panel speak at Power of Peer Support conference in Limerick

Printer-friendly versionPrinter-friendly version

Headstrong’s Youth Advisory Panel (YAP) receives many requests to speak at conferences and events throughout the country. One such request was from the Community Recovery and Reconnect (RNR) project that received funding from Genio in September 2010 to run a pilot, community-based project with an emphasis on peer support.

Among the project’s aims are the development of peer-led training, workshops, support groups and initiatives in the mid west regions including Limerick, Clare and North Tipperary. The YAP was invited to speak at a conference titled The Power of Peer Support held on December 1st in Limerick.

Darren Scully and Daire Ni Bhraoin volunteered to represent YAP and the main theme of their presentation focused on the importance of listening to your target group when delivering a project. They emphasised how the strength of Headstrong is the organisation’s ability to listen to and work with young people in a collaborative manner and take their views on board.

Youth Engagement Officer James Barry who attended the session said: “This was my first time to attend such an event with YAP members and it was quite powerful to see the effect they had on the room. The maturity and delivery of their presentation allowed them to engage with their audience whilst also showing the attendees that young people can have a voice."
